Planning Your Spring Break: Tips and Tricks
Alright, let's talk planning. A successful spring break requires a little more than just booking a flight or packing a bag. Here are some essential tips and tricks to ensure your break is smooth, stress-free, and filled with fun. First and foremost, book your accommodations and transportation in advance. This is especially crucial if you're traveling during peak season. Prices tend to increase as the dates get closer, so booking early can save you a significant amount of money. Plus, you'll have a wider selection of options to choose from, ensuring you get the best deals and the most convenient locations. Next, create a budget and stick to it. Determine how much you can realistically spend on your spring break, and allocate funds for transportation, accommodation, activities, food, and souvenirs. It's helpful to track your expenses throughout the trip to avoid overspending. And don't forget to pack appropriately for your destination and activities. Consider the climate, the terrain, and the types of activities you'll be participating in, and pack accordingly. Pack comfortable shoes for walking, swimwear for the beach, and layers for cooler evenings. It's also a good idea to pack a first-aid kit, sunscreen, and insect repellent. Safety is paramount, so be aware of your surroundings and take precautions to protect yourself and your belongings. Avoid walking alone at night, keep your valuables secure, and be mindful of your alcohol consumption. It's also a good idea to share your itinerary with a friend or family member, so they know your whereabouts and can reach you in case of an emergency. Finally, don't forget to relax and have fun!
